
Owls Head Light

by Brenda Giasson
Title
Owls Head Light
Artist
Brenda Giasson
Medium
Photograph - Photography
Description
Owls Head considered the most haunted lighthouse in America. They offer trips to stay overnight. That is if you dare...
Uploaded
January 14th, 2012
Embed
Share